UK Labour Leader Keir Starmer Faces Challenge Amidst Internal Party Politics

South Africa5 d ago

The Labour Party in the United Kingdom is facing a significant internal challenge that could impact the leadership of Keir Starmer. A prominent figure, referred to as the 'King of the North,' is reportedly preparing to contest Starmer's position. This internal contest is seen as a critical juncture for Starmer's tenure as leader. The outcome of this challenge could either signal the beginning of the end for his leadership or provide him with an opportunity to regain support. The political landscape within the Labour Party appears to be in a state of flux.
